Ora Reasoner, 91, a loving mother and grandmother, passed away Friday, June 29, 2007.Ora Strickland Reasoner was born March 31, 1916, in Comanche County, Texas, daughter of the late Jackson B. and Dora Haddon Strickland.She married Marion Reasoner on June 29, 1941, in Brown County, Texas. Ora taught in Zephyr and Castleberry schools. A 54 year member of Ash Creek Baptist Church, Ora wrote the history of the church and taught Sunday School for many of those years. She was an active member of the knitting club and a volunteer at the Azle Library.She was preceded in death by her husband, Marion Reasoner in 2004; four brothers and two sisters.Survivors include sons, Harold Reasoner and wife, Jodie, James Reasoner and wife, Livia; daughter, Norma Kinchen and husband, John; grandchildren, David, Neal and Steven Reasoner, Travis Kinchen, Jennifer Arthur, Shayna and Joanna Reasoner; great-grandchildren, Haley and James Arthur, Cassandra Kinchen and Drake Reasoner; brother, Wiley Strickland; and several nieces and nephews.Funeral services are scheduled 10 a.m. Monday, July 2, 2007 at Ash Creek Baptist Church in Azle. Burial will follow in Azleland Cemetery, Azle. The family will receive guests 3 to 5 p.m. Sunday at White's Azle Funeral Home. Memorial donations may be made to the Ash Creek Baptist Church Building Fund, 300 S. Stewart Street, Azle 76020.
